Researchers at Environment Canada have found that vehicle exhaust is a significant source of isocyanic acid (HNCO), a toxic gaseous acid that is a product of various forms of combustion and a potential health concern. Automobile exhaust is also a known source of inorganic acids such as nitric (HNO 3 ) and nitrous (HONO) acids.

A remote vehicle exhaust sensor (Fuel Efficiency Automobile Test, FEAT), developed at the University of Denver, collected the data sets. FEAT measures vehicle exhaust gases as a ratio to exhaust CO 2 because the path length of the plume is unknown, and the ratios are constant for a given exhaust plume. Technol. ,

Since the boiling point of liquid air is far below ambient temperatures, the environment can provide all the heat needed to make liquid air boil. The Dearman Engine Company Limited (DEC) is developing a novel, zero-emission piston engine that runs on liquid air (or liquid nitrogen); the exhaust is cold air. Compressed air engines (e.g.,
